Important Notes:
Some discs may take a few seconds to load. If a disc is inserted incorrectly, dirty, or
damaged, "NO DISC" will appear in the display.
Always hold the disc without touching either of its surfaces. When inserting a disc,
position it with the printed title side facing up, align it with the guides and place it in
its proper position.
It is important that you read the manual that accompanies the DVD disc as there are
features that are on this DVD player that cannot be used with certain DVDs. There are
also extra features that are different for each DVD disc that are not explained in this
owner's manual.
